From earlier this morning:

Point in case, I’m at the gym and using the iPad and a program called Day One to get some words on the page today. I just wrote a scene for our book “Ni”, which Nick and I are working on for nano this year. It’s book 2 in our urban fantasy crime series. it’s taking an entirely different route than when we started it. part of that is happening as we write it and part of it with brainstorming discussions that happen anywhere from our kitchen to the soccer fields or even via text messages.

I’ll say this, writing on the bike isn’t easy on the arms, but it’s definitely getting the words on the page. and one better, this will sync so that when I’m back at my desk, it’s a simple as dropping it into scrivener and my blog post, helping. Me to keep track of our overall word count!

Write on!
